Understanding the Shift Toward Accessibility
Historically, online gaming required substantial infrastructure, high investment thresholds, and technical expertise. However, the advent of cloud-based gaming, simplified user interfaces, and initiatives aimed at promoting responsible gaming have democratized access. Today, players can engage with a diverse array of titles with minimal barriers.
Industry Data: Recent statistics from the UK Gambling Commission indicate that online gaming participation increased by over 25% in the past three years, with a notable proportion of new players entering through mobile devices and web-based platforms. This trend underscores the importance of intuitive, easily accessible digital environments.
The Role of Free Demo Platforms in Promoting Responsible Gaming
One of the key innovations fostering responsible gaming practices involves the integration of free-to-play or demo versions of popular titles. These platforms allow users to familiarize themselves with game mechanics, assess their own betting behaviors, and practice strategies without financial risks.
For example, industries have observed a significant uptick in user engagement when free demos are available, as they serve both as entertainment and as an educational tool. Furthermore, responsible operators often embed features that promote moderation, such as session timers and self-exclusion prompts.
This approach aligns with the broader ethical standards increasingly championed across the gaming industry—prioritizing player well-being and fostering trust.
